Forget Harry Potter. Daniel Radcliffe's dream role? "I think part of me would love to play a drag queen," he says in the October issue of Details. "It would be an excuse to wear loads of eye makeup." It wouldn't be the first controversial role the 19-year-old star has tackled. Radcliffe - who recently revealed he suffers from a mild brain disorder that sometimes prohibits him from tying his shoes - has appeared fully nude in the play Equus in London. He will strip down again for the play in a limited engagement on Broadway beginning September 5. His private life is considerably less racy. "I don't pretend to do anything particularly wild," he tells the magazine. "People talk about rebellion and they say, 'Where is the teenage angst?' "But I say I try to do it simply by the choices I make in the work I do," Radcliffe goes on. "I just like wrong-footing people. I write poetry and I love it. I like being different from most other people in my generation." The star — who earned an estimated $50 million for the last two Harry Potter films — goes on to say he isn't blowing through his bucks. "The only thing I'm likely to spend on is artwork," he says, "'cause that's the only thing I'm interested in that costs a lot of money." See what your favorite teen stars looked like two years ago. |
